web-dev-qa-db-ja.com

テキストをASCII / ISO-8859-1に変換する

理想的にはUTF-8(ただしISO-8859-2とWINDOWS-1250で問題ありません)からASCII/ISO-8859-1にテキストを変換できるツールを探していますか?

私はいくつかのオンライン音訳ツールを見ましたが、コマンドラインに何かが必要です(そしてiconvはファイルの変換を拒否しています)。

4
Šimon Tóth

デフォルトでは、iconvは、ターゲット文字セットに存在しない文字が含まれている場合、ファイルの変換を拒否します。使用する //TRANSLITそのような文字を「ダウングレード」します。

iconv -f utf-8 -t iso8859-1//TRANSLIT

Pythonを使用しても問題がない場合は、é => eなどの文字変換を行うために作成された slugify を試してみてください。そして、変換をフォーマットするために使用されるkonwertについて言及している私の以前の答えを忘れてください。

0